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?php
- class Auth extends CI_Controller{
- function __construct()
- {
- parent::__construct();
- $this->load->model('Users_model');
- }
- function login(){
- if(isset($_POST['submit'])) {
- //proses login disini
- $username=$this->input->post('username');
- $password=$this->input->post('password');
- $hasil=$this->Users_model->login($username,$password);
- if($hasil==1){
- //update last login
- $this->session->userdata(array('status_login'=>'oke')); //menyimpan session
- redirect('dashboard'); //redirect success
- }else{
- redirect('auth/login'); //saat login gagal
- }
- }else{
- //$this->load->view('form_login'); //tampilkan halaman login jika tidak ada aksi kirim
- check_session_login(); //memangil method saat login sudah selesai
- $this->template->load('template_login','form_login');
- }
- }
- function logout(){
- //method untuk destroy sesion website
- $this->session->sess_destroy();
- redirect('auth/login');
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ement